问题:使用VMware构建了一个本地CentOS虚拟机之后,经过Xshell链接虚拟机,在使用桥接的网络链接方式。每次从新链接虚拟机时,虚拟机IP地址不断改变,很是不方便。所以如今将虚拟机的IP地址设为固定地址。shell
解决方法步骤:vim
一、查看本地IP地址(打开命令控制台--->ipconfig),虚拟机的设置须要在同一个网段,以下图:网络
二、设置虚拟机VMnet8的IP地址,以下图:编辑器
三、设置VMware虚拟网络编辑器,以下图:spa
四、设置NAT模式3d
五、NAT网关设置rest
六、使用root帐号登陆到虚拟机CentOS系统,切换目录到: /etc/sysconfig/network-scripts/,使用 ls 命令查看文件目录。 以下图:blog
七、使用vi(或者vim)编辑ifcfg-eno16777736(根据我的状况定),以下图:ip
须要修改的内容(没有就添加)如上图所示:虚拟机
BOOTPROTO=static(使用静态IP)
DNS1=114.114.114.114(国内通用)
IPADDR=192.168.190.133(自定义的IP地址,与真实机相比只有最后一个数不一样,其余自定义)
NETMASK=255.255.255.0
GATEWAY=192.168.190.2(填写在第5步【NAT网关设置】的IP地址)
........
ONBOOT=yes(是否激活网卡,填写yes)
注意:进入编辑之后须要先按“i”(英文状态下的i)进入编辑模式,编辑完成之后按“Esc”案件,而后按“:”(英文状态下的冒号),在按:wq(保存并退出) 回车。
八、完成之后重启网卡: service network restart
九、检测是否正常上网: ping taobao.com
如上图所示,可以正常返回证实能够正常上网。
十、使用Xshell链接虚拟机,以下图:
如图所示:新建一个链接,输入虚拟机的IP地址(前面设置了,若是忘了使用ipconfig或者ip addr命令查看,以下图),点击链接,输入用户名和密码就链接上了本机的CentOS系统。